Explorers Expansion Updates

We have some incredibly exciting news to share with our Durango community! Explorers Early Childhood Education is embarking on a major expansion project to tackle our region's childcare crisis head-on. We are moving from our temporary location into a permanent, purpose-built campus designed to nurture our youngest learners for generations to come.

 

Located at the corner of County Road 250 and Metz Lane (117 Metz Lane and 123 Metz Lane), our new facility will allow us to grow our impact by leaps and bounds. We are expanding from our current 12 preschool slots per day to 56 total slots per day, serving an estimated 75 children annually. Explorers will offer 16 desperately needed infant and toddler spots (6 infant slots and 10 toddler slots), alongside 40 expanded preschool slots. The new campus features a seamless learning continuum for ages 6 weeks to 6 years and will include Durango’s first dual language immersion program.

 

In addition to developmentally designed classroom spaces, this campus will feature a dedicated indoor spaces for art, science, and movement, an outdoor classroom, age-appropriate playgrounds, a full kitchen allowing a food program in the future, and on-site professional training opportunities. With the help of Responsive Designs, Elevation Custom Renovations, and many of our local businesses, we are creating a space the is true to our mission and invites families of all income levels to access premium early education.

 

We look forward to welcoming you all to our new home this fall, where every child can play, learn, and grow in an environment rooted in curiosity, creativity, and connection.
